Bezier Class Reference
[Trajectory]

Implements a clotoide path. More...

#include <Path.h>

Inheritance diagram for Bezier:

Path

List of all members.

Public Member Functions

int factorial (int n)
 Bezier (vector< Position > pointsAtt)
Position evalCentredPos (Decimal s)
 Implementation of coresponding pure virtual function.
Position evalCentredPosp (Decimal s)
 Implementation of coresponding pure virtual function.
Position evalCentredPospp (Decimal s)
 Implementation of coresponding pure virtual function.
Angle evalTheta (Decimal s)
 Implementation of coresponding pure virtual function.
Angle evalThetap (Decimal s, Decimal sp)
 Implementation of coresponding pure virtual function.
Angle evalThetapp (Decimal s, Decimal sp, Decimal spp)
 Implementation of coresponding pure virtual function.

Public Attributes

vector< Decimal_weightAtt
vector< Decimal_weightRep
vector< Decimal_xAtt
vector< Decimal_yAtt
vector< Decimal_xRep
vector< Decimal_yRep
vector< int > _binomialAtt
vector< int > _binomialRep


Detailed Description

Implements a clotoide path.

Author:
Antonio Franchi and Marco Barbalinardo - email:barba82@yahoo.it
Date:
2008/12/02
Todo:
descrizione parametri

Constructor & Destructor Documentation

Bezier::Bezier ( vector< Position pointsAtt  )  [inline]


Member Function Documentation

int Bezier::factorial ( int  n  )  [inline]

Position Bezier::evalCentredPos ( Decimal  s  )  [inline, virtual]

Implementation of coresponding pure virtual function.

Implements Path.

Position Bezier::evalCentredPosp ( Decimal  s  )  [inline, virtual]

Implementation of coresponding pure virtual function.

Implements Path.

Position Bezier::evalCentredPospp ( Decimal  s  )  [inline, virtual]

Implementation of coresponding pure virtual function.

Implements Path.

Angle Bezier::evalTheta ( Decimal  s  )  [inline, virtual]

Implementation of coresponding pure virtual function.

Implements Path.

Angle Bezier::evalThetap ( Decimal  s,
Decimal  sp 
) [inline, virtual]

Implementation of coresponding pure virtual function.

Implements Path.

Angle Bezier::evalThetapp ( Decimal  s,
Decimal  sp,
Decimal  spp 
) [inline, virtual]

Implementation of coresponding pure virtual function.

Implements Path.


Member Data Documentation

vector<int> Bezier::_binomialAtt

vector<int> Bezier::_binomialRep


The documentation for this class was generated from the following file:

Generated on Mon Feb 20 07:01:09 2017 for MIP by  doxygen 1.5.6